The embattled Methodist Presiding Bishop who was plucked out of office on Wednesday last week, has come out guns blazing, accusing those who were behind his attempted ouster as betrayers. Reverend Joseph Ntombura says he's still the Presiding Bishop of the Methodist church, until his term officially ends this year. He also alleges that his life is in danger, following a series of social media attacks and some unknown vehicles are trailing him, and now wants the former Presiding Bishops to desist from interfering with the Church’s transition.
